DeepSeek has committed to acquiring 160,000 Huawei Ascend 950DT chips to fuel a substantial new AI inference cluster located in Inner Mongolia.

This massive hardware procurement signals a significant scaling effort by the developer in China’s domestic artificial intelligence infrastructure market. The deployment centers on high-volume inference workloads, requiring immense parallel processing capability to serve large-scale user demands for DeepSeek’s models.

The decision to utilize Huawei’s Ascend 950DT processors over competing international hardware represents a deliberate strategic alignment with the strengthening domestic semiconductor ecosystem. The Ascend chips are specifically engineered to handle the intensive matrix operations characteristic of large language model (LLM) inference at scale, making them a foundational component for modern AI operations.

The Inner Mongolia location provides strategic advantages for hosting such a large-scale computing cluster, offering access to robust power infrastructure and favorable geographic positioning for data processing and network latency management within the Chinese national grid. The infrastructure development is not merely an expansion of capacity but a foundational investment in resilient, domestically controlled AI computing power.

The sheer quantity of chips—160,000 units—underscores the aggressive growth trajectory DeepSeek projects for its services. Inference capacity, the ability to run a trained model to generate responses, is the primary bottleneck in deploying state-of-the-art AI services to millions of users. By securing this volume of specialized hardware, DeepSeek directly addresses this scaling challenge.

Strategic Alignment with Domestic Hardware

The procurement acts as a powerful validation of the Ascend architecture within the high-end AI sector. By integrating these chips into a critical production cluster, DeepSeek provides substantial real-world demand data that benefits Huawei’s hardware development roadmap.

This trend reflects a broader, accelerating national imperative across the technology sector to reduce reliance on foreign-manufactured GPUs. Companies like DeepSeek are actively participating in the localization of the AI stack, moving from pilot testing to full-scale deployment using homegrown silicon solutions.

The Ascend 950DT is designed for high-performance computing tailored to specific deep learning frameworks, making it highly efficient for the iterative demands of inference tasks. This contrasts with general-purpose computing architectures, allowing for optimized power consumption and throughput crucial for operational data centers.

Industry analysts note that this move solidifies DeepSeek’s competitive posture, allowing it to maintain high service levels while potentially mitigating supply chain risks associated with international chip dependencies. The cluster's establishment represents a concrete step toward achieving true operational sovereignty in advanced AI deployment.
